BACKGROUND: Lung resection is a controversial and understudied therapeutic modality in Primary Ciliary Dyskinesia (PCD). We assessed the prevalence of lung resection in PCD across countries and compared disease course in lobectomised and non-lobectomised patients. METHODS: In the international iPCD cohort, we identified lobectomised and non-lobectomised age and sex-matched PCD patients and compared their characteristics, lung function and BMI cross-sectionally and longitudinally. RESULTS: Among 2896 patients in the iPCD cohort, 163 from 20 centers (15 countries) underwent lung resection (5.6%). Among adult patients, prevalence of lung resection was 8.9%, demonstrating wide variation among countries. Compared to the rest of the iPCD cohort, lobectomised patients were more often females, older at diagnosis, and more often had situs solitus. In about half of the cases (45.6%) lung resection was performed before presentation to specialized PCD centers for diagnostic work-up. Compared to controls (n = 197), lobectomised patients had lower FVC z-scores (- 2.41 vs - 1.35, p = 0.0001) and FEV1 z-scores (- 2.79 vs - 1.99, p = 0.003) at their first post-lung resection assessment. After surgery, lung function continued to decline at a faster rate in lobectomised patients compared to controls (FVC z-score slope: - 0.037/year Vs - 0.009/year, p = 0.047 and FEV1 z-score slope: - 0.052/year Vs - 0.033/year, p = 0.235), although difference did not reach statistical significance for FEV1. Within cases, females and patients with multiple lobe resections had lower lung function. CONCLUSIONS: Prevalence of lung resection in PCD varies widely between countries, is often performed before PCD diagnosis and overall is more frequent in patients with delayed diagnosis. After lung resection, compared to controls most lobectomised patients have poorer and continuing decline of lung function despite lung resection. Further studies benefiting from prospective data collection are needed to confirm these findings.

Bronchoscopy is an established procedure routinely used by pediatric pulmonologists. Despite its frequent application, data on complications and specific risk factors are scarce and sometimes conflicting. AIM: The aim of this study was to evaluate frequency and severity of clearly defined complications of bronchoscopy in children that occur both during and after the procedure, and to identify potential risk factors. METHOD: A retrospective single-center analysis of 670 elective bronchoscopies in 522 children aged 0-17 years during the time period of 2008-2012 was performed. Procedures in intensive care unit patients and children after lung transplantation were excluded. RESULTS: Mean patient age was 5.58 years, 61.5% had underlying chronic diseases. Intraprocedural complications occurred in 7.2% of all procedures; of these, hypoxemia was the most common, occuring in 4.8% of cases. Postprocedural adverse events were documented in 25.8%, the most frequent of which were fever in 14.2% and transient oxygen dependency in 13.4% of cases. No bronchoscopy related deaths occurred. Multivariate logistic regression was used to identify risk factors for (1) any complication, or (2) severe complications. Age below two years (OR 1.837 [1.224-2.757], P = 0.003) and primary ciliary dyskinesia (OR 4.821 [2.018-11.552], P < 0.001) significantly contributed to risk of any complication. Age below 2 years (OR 2.478 [1.072-5.728], P = 0.034) and underlying cardiovascular disease (OR 2.678 [1.013-7.077], P = 0.047) were independent risk factors for severe complications. CONCLUSION: Bronchoscopy in children is relatively safe. Nevertheless, adverse events can occur and knowledge of risk factors may help prevent complications.

Genetic factors and mechanisms underlying food allergy are largely unknown. Due to heterogeneity of symptoms a reliable diagnosis is often difficult to make. Here, we report a genome-wide association study on food allergy diagnosed by oral food challenge in 497 cases and 2387 controls. We identify five loci at genome-wide significance, the clade B serpin (SERPINB) gene cluster at 18q21.3, the cytokine gene cluster at 5q31.1, the filaggrin gene, the C11orf30/LRRC32 locus, and the human leukocyte antigen (HLA) region. Stratifying the results for the causative food demonstrates that association of the HLA locus is peanut allergy-specific whereas the other four loci increase the risk for any food allergy. Variants in the SERPINB gene cluster are associated with SERPINB10 expression in leukocytes. Moreover, SERPINB genes are highly expressed in the esophagus. All identified loci are involved in immunological regulation or epithelial barrier function, emphasizing the role of both mechanisms in food allergy.

BACKGROUND: Airway infections in Primary Ciliary Dyskinesia (PCD) are caused by different microorganisms, including pseudomonas aeruginosa (PA). The aim of this study was to investigate the association of PA colonization and the progression of lung disease in PCD. METHODS: Data from 11PCD centers were retrospectively collected from 2008 to 2013. Patients were considered colonized if PA grew on at least two separate sputum cultures; otherwise, they were classified as non-colonized. These two groups were compared on the lung function computed tomography (CT) Brody score and other clinical parameters. RESULTS: Data were available from 217 patients; 60 (27.6%) of whom were assigned to the colonized group. Patients colonized with PA were older and were diagnosed at a later age. Baseline forced expiratory volume at 1 s (FEV1) was lower in the colonized group (72.4 ± 22.0 vs. 80.1 ± 18.9, % predicted, p = 0.015), but FEV1 declined throughout the study period was similar in both groups. The colonized group had significantly worse CT-Brody scores (36.07 ± 24.38 vs. 25.56 ± 24.2, p = 0.034). A subgroup analysis with more stringent definitions of colonization revealed similar results. CONCLUSIONS: Lung PA colonization in PCD is associated with more severe disease as shown by the FEV1 and CT score. However, the magnitude of decline in pulmonary function was similar in colonized and non-colonized PCD patients.

Primary ciliary dyskinesia (PCD) is a rare heterogenous condition that causes progressive suppurative lung disease, chronic rhinosinusitis, chronic otitis media, infertility and abnormal situs. 'Better Experimental Approaches to Treat Primary Ciliary Dyskinesia' (BEAT-PCD) is a network of scientists and clinicians coordinating research from basic science through to clinical care with the intention of developing treatments and diagnostics that lead to improved long-term outcomes for patients. BEAT-PCD activities are supported by EU Framework Programme Horizon 2020 funded COST Action (BM1407). The Inaugural Conference of BEAT-PCD was held in December 2015 in Southampton, UK. The conference attracted ninety-six scientists, clinicians, allied health professionals, industrial partners and patient representatives from twenty countries. We aimed to identify the needs for PCD research and clinical care, particularly focussing on basic science, epidemiology, diagnostic testing, clinical management and clinical trials. The multidisciplinary conference provided an interactive platform for exchanging ideas through a program of lectures, poster presentations, breakout sessions and workshops. This allowed us to develop plans for collaborative studies. In this report, we summarize the meeting, highlight developments, and discuss open questions thereby documenting ongoing developments in the field of PCD research.
